Volunteers wanted for Lactation project

Are you interested in supporting Rainbow Families in the current lactation and human milk feeding project that is in partnership with the Australian Breastfeeding Association (ABA)?

Bridget Muir is on the Rainbow Families Welfare Committee and is seeking someone to join forces with them in the final stages of this huge and important resource for our community. You will get experience in seeing how a partnership project comes together. This volunteer role would include attending a monthly meeting between Rainbow Families and the ABA.

You and Bridget would be representing Rainbow Families at these meetings. You will also get to be part of the working group currently developing the lactation classes. No lactation or human feeding experience is necessary for this role. But an interest in partnership projects and programming would be great.
